Pilih Linter dan Formatter Terbaik untuk Tim Anda di Tahun 2026
Ketahui tentang linter dan formatter terbaik untuk tim yang dapat meningkatkan produktivitas dan kualitas kode. Dari ESLint hingga RuboCop dan Prettier.
Mengembangkan aplikasi yang kompleks membutuhkan tim ahli yang berkolaborasi secara erat. Namun, dalam proses pengembangan, perlu diingat bahwa kode yang baik adalah kunci sukses. Oleh karena itu, penting bagi tim Anda untuk memiliki alat yang tepat untuk meningkatkan kualitas kode, yaitu linter dan formatter.
Linter Terbaik untuk Tim
Dibawah ini adalah beberapa linter terbaik yang dapat digunakan oleh tim Anda.
ESLint
ESLint adalah salah satu linter paling populer di dunia pengembangan web. Alat ini dapat mendeteksi kesalahan sintaks dan pola kode yang tidak baik, sehingga meningkatkan kualitas kode dan mengurangi masalah yang timbul.
RuboCop
RuboCop adalah linter yang dirancang khusus untuk bahasa pemrograman Ruby. Alat ini dapat mendeteksi kesalahan sintaks dan pola kode yang tidak baik, serta memberikan saran untuk meningkatkan kualitas kode.
Bandit
Bandit adalah linter yang dirancang khusus untuk bahasa pemrograman Python. Alat ini dapat mendeteksi kesalahan sintaks dan pola kode yang tidak baik, serta memberikan saran untuk meningkatkan kualitas kode.
Formatter Terbaik untuk Tim
Dibawah ini adalah beberapa formatter terbaik yang dapat digunakan oleh tim Anda.
Prettier
Prettier adalah formatter yang paling populer di dunia pengembangan web. Alat ini dapat mengatur tata letak kode dengan baik, sehingga meningkatkan kualitas kode dan mengurangi masalah yang timbul.
Black
Black adalah formatter yang dirancang khusus untuk bahasa pemrograman Python. Alat ini dapat mengatur tata letak kode dengan baik, serta memberikan saran untuk meningkatkan kualitas kode.
Clang-Format
Clang-Format adalah formatter yang dirancang khusus untuk bahasa pemrograman C++. Alat ini dapat mengatur tata letak kode dengan baik, serta memberikan saran untuk meningkatkan kualitas kode.
Memilih linter dan formatter yang tepat dapat membantu tim Anda meningkatkan produktivitas dan kualitas kode. Pastikan Anda untuk mencari alat yang sesuai dengan kebutuhan tim Anda dan melakukan pelatihan yang tepat untuk memastikan bahwa tim Anda dapat menggunakannya dengan efektif.